    In addition to being famous for ceramics, there is a very distinctive appearance, stepping into the park as if strolling in the 18th century German town, because the architecture in the park is completely German style. There is a kiln for burning paper porcelain on the hillside in the distance, and there is also a small shop where you can experience the handmade porcelain. You can try it when you have time. There are drugstores and duty-free shops next to the ceramic park for tourists to shop.

    Yota is Japan's "Jingde Town", the birthplace of fine white porcelain. When you come to Yota Ceramics Park, it will feel like you are in Europe, because there is a 18th-century German palace building, "Zwenger Palace". From the appearance, you can see many wonderful sculptures of characters, and the ceramic fountain also plays a role in the finishing touch. The interior of the palace is a ceramic museum.
